Plant removal is an essential practice for maintaining healthy landscapes, handling overgrowth, and preparing areas for new plantings or hardscape installations. This process consists of getting rid of weeds, shrubs, little trees, or intrusive species, making sure to extract roots to prevent regrowth. Correct techniques avoid damage to surrounding plants and soil structure. Mechanical elimination, hand digging, or chemical treatments may be used depending on plant type and site conditions. Post-removal, soil amendment and grading make sure that the area appropriates for replanting, lawn installation, or other landscape enhancements. Regular plant elimination supports landscape visual appeals, reduces insect and disease pressures, and improves general plant health. Correctly handled removal prepares the home for sustainable and aesthetically appealing outside environments
